The Rock-It Company is a market leader in two expansive logistics and project management sectors across the globe: live events encompassing live music sports and broadcasting film and TV and experiential events and exhibitions; and luxury goods focused on fine art automotive and fashion. Rock-It which began in 1978 serving Led Zeppelin includes Rock-it Cargo Rock-It Sports Rock-It Productions Rock-It Experiential Dietl CARS Dynamic International and more. Rock-Its premier team manages bespoke global logistics through end-to-end services including multimodal freight event logistics planning and custom storage and distribution solutions. This service delivery leverages an unparalleled global network with over 10000 missions a year. DIETL by Rock-It supports a worldwide network of collectors auction houses galleries and museums with specialized freight forwarding customs brokerage and secure climate-controlled storage.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Coordinate all aspects of domestic and international fine art shipments and related projects for the Los Angeles Museums & Exhibitions team.
  • Complete and maintain required TSA training and certifications while ensuring shipment compliance with applicable TSA regulations.
  • Coordinate logistics with clients vendors carriers agents and internal teams to manage schedules budgets documentation and project requirements.
  • Prepare project estimates budgets and transportation plans including routing recommendations and scheduling.
  • Open and manage shipment files for import export domestic and international movements.
  • Arrange transportation services by booking airlines trucking companies crate shops art handlers supervision agents and other service providers.
  • Prepare and process shipping and customs documentation including air waybills (AWBs) packing lists delivery orders AES filings and other import/export documents.
  • Research import and export regulations obtain required permits and coordinate U.S. Customs entry documentation.
  • Prepare shipment and courier itineraries and provide clients with timely shipment status updates throughout the project lifecycle.
  • Create and submit invoices ensuring accurate billing and project documentation.
  • Provide administrative and operational support to the Los Angeles and U.S. Museums & Exhibitions teams.
  • Participate in client meetings and events and collaborate with colleagues to support additional shipments and special projects as needed.
